- Ktorý triediaci algoritmus sa mám naučiť?
- Potrebujem si zapamätať triediace algoritmy??
- Koľko techník triedenia je v dátovej štruktúre?
- Prečo používame rôzne techniky triedenia?
- Čo sú techniky triedenia v dátovej štruktúre?
- Koľko algoritmov triedenia je k dispozícii?
- Čo je triedenie v Pythone?
- Prečo potrebujeme triedenie v dátovej štruktúre?
- Ktorá z nasledujúcich techník triedenia je najúčinnejšia, ak je rozsah?
- Čo je triedenie, podrobne vysvetlite?
Ktorý triediaci algoritmus sa mám naučiť?
Najdôležitejšie triediace algoritmy pre rozhovory sú O(n*log(n)) algoritmy. Dva z najbežnejších algoritmov v tejto triede sú zlučovacie triedenie a rýchle triedenie. ... Odporúčam začať zlučovacím zoradením, pretože má časovú zložitosť v najhoršom prípade O(n*log(n)), zatiaľ čo rýchle zoradenie klesne na najhorší prípad O(n²).
Potrebujem si zapamätať triediace algoritmy??
V skutočnosti nejde o zapamätanie. Je to záležitosť hlbokého pochopenia všeobecných tried algoritmov ako rozdeľ a panuj. Ak naozaj rozumiete rozdeľovaniu a panovaniu, nemusíte sa rýchlo triediť naspamäť. Podľa potreby ho môžete na mieste znovu odvodiť.
Koľko techník triedenia je v dátovej štruktúre?
Tri typy základného triedenia sú bublinové triedenie, vkladanie triedenie a triedenie výberu.
Prečo používame rôzne techniky triedenia?
Zoradenie zoznamu položiek môže trvať dlho, najmä ak ide o veľký zoznam. Na tento účel je možné vytvoriť počítačový program, ktorý značne zjednoduší triedenie zoznamu údajov. Existuje mnoho typov triediacich algoritmov.
Čo sú techniky triedenia v dátovej štruktúre?
Reklamy. Triedenie sa týka usporiadania údajov v určitom formáte. Algoritmus triedenia určuje spôsob usporiadania údajov v určitom poradí. Najbežnejšie poradia sú v číselnom alebo lexikografickom poradí.
Koľko algoritmov triedenia je k dispozícii?
Aj keď existuje široká škála triediacich algoritmov, tento blog vysvetľuje priame vkladanie, triedenie podľa škrupín, bublinové triedenie, rýchle triedenie, triedenie výberu a triedenie haldy. Prvé dva algoritmy (Straight Insertion a Shell Sort) triedia polia s vložením, čo znamená, že sa prvky vložia na správne miesto.
Čo je triedenie v Pythone?
Triedenie sa týka usporiadania údajov v určitom formáte. Algoritmus triedenia určuje spôsob usporiadania údajov v určitom poradí. Najbežnejšie poradia sú v číselnom alebo lexikografickom poradí. ... Triedenie sa používa aj na zobrazenie údajov v čitateľnejších formátoch. Nižšie vidíme päť takýchto implementácií triedenia v pythone.
Prečo potrebujeme triedenie v dátovej štruktúre?
Usporiadanie údajov v preferovanom poradí sa v dátovej štruktúre nazýva triedenie. Vďaka triedeniu údajov je jednoduchšie v nich rýchlo a jednoducho vyhľadávať. Najjednoduchším príkladom triedenia je slovník.
Ktorá z nasledujúcich techník triedenia je najúčinnejšia, ak je rozsah?
Vysvetlenie: Triedenie podľa počítania je veľmi efektívne v prípadoch, keď je rozsah porovnateľný s počtom vstupných prvkov, pretože vykonáva triedenie v lineárnom čase. 13.
Čo je triedenie, podrobne vysvetlite?
Triedenie je akýkoľvek proces systematického usporiadania položiek a má dva spoločné, ale odlišné významy: zoradenie: usporiadanie položiek v poradí usporiadanom podľa nejakého kritéria; kategorizácia: zoskupovanie položiek s podobnými vlastnosťami.